Complexity and Feedback During Script Training in Aphasia: A Feasibility Study
Leora R Cherney1, Sarel Van Vuuren2
1Center for Aphasia Research and Treatment, Shirley Ryan AbilityLab, Chicago, Illinois; Department of Physical Medicine and Rehabilitation, Northwestern University Feinberg School of Medicine, Chicago, Illinois; Department of Communication Sciences and Disorders, Northwestern University, Evanston, Illinois.
Script training for aphasia is effective, especially with more complex scripts. Higher complexity improved accuracy in script production and maintenance for individuals with aphasia.

Background:
- Aphasia, a communication disorder resulting from brain damage, significantly impacts individuals' ability to produce and comprehend language.
- Script training has emerged as a promising therapeutic approach for improving communication in aphasia.
Purpose of the Study:
- To investigate the impact of script complexity and feedback on the effectiveness of computer-based script training in adults with aphasia.
- To determine if higher complexity or specific feedback conditions enhance script production accuracy and rate.
Main Methods:
- A randomized, single-blind, 2x2 factorial design was employed with adults diagnosed with fluent and nonfluent aphasia.
- Participants engaged in a 3-week intensive program using the AphasiaScripts software, practicing scripts at varying complexity levels with different feedback conditions.
Main Results:
- Script training led to statistically significant improvements in accuracy and production rate for trained scripts, maintained up to 12 weeks post-treatment.
- Higher script complexity positively influenced accuracy at post-treatment and during maintenance phases.
- Individuals with nonfluent aphasia demonstrated greater gains compared to those with fluent aphasia; feedback did not show a significant effect.
Conclusions:
- Script training is a viable treatment for aphasia, with complex scripts enhancing skill acquisition and retention.
- Further research with larger sample sizes and diverse aphasia types is recommended to explore these variables further.
